AOD Tuyer Pipe

An AOD tuyere pipe is a critical refractory component used in the Argon Oxygen Decarburization (AOD) process for refining stainless steel and specialty alloys. It is responsible for injecting oxygen and inert gases (argon/nitrogen) into the molten metal, facilitating decarburization, desulfurization, and alloy recovery.

Key Properties of AOD Tuyere Pipes
1. Material Composition: High-purity magnesia-chrome refractories with fused grain.
2. Density: Typically ranges from 2,800–3,100 kg/m³, ensuring durability.
3. Thermal Conductivity: Optimized for heat retention and controlled gas injection.
4. Maximum Operating Temperature: Up to 1,750°C, ensuring longevity in molten metal environments.
5. Erosion & Corrosion Resistance: Protects against slag and molten steel attack.

Types of AOD Tuyere Pipes
Standard Tuyeres: Designed for controlled gas injection and wear resistance.
Calibrated Tuyeres: Maintain uniform gas flow despite refractory wear.
Specialized Tuyeres: Custom designs for specific AOD vessel configurations.

Applications of AOD Tuyere Pipes
Steel Refining: Enhances decarburization and alloy recovery.
Slag Control: Improves desulfurization and impurity removal.
Process Optimization: Ensures efficient mixing and reaction kinetics.
